Because I'm 100% convinced that if I didn't, someone else would. And, as a general rule, I trust myself to make good decisions more than others.
abgemacht, you would not be alone in attempting to do so. Эvalanche: That's the problem with true anarchy. If you could guarantee that everyone would seek fair, peaceful resolutions to their problems, sure, anarchy would be ideal. Unfortunately there's a little thing called selfishness. There will always be people who will want more and to be in charge, and they will take what they can by force.
Tergem (100 D)
05 Mar 11 UTC
One person would use diplomacy to gain allies and followers, this person would build a tribe with a basic structure. This tribe would then seek to protect its structure, so it would create rules that will be enforced. What do you know, we are back where we started this whole mess.

Utopian anarchy would be nice, but that is what it is. Utopian, unattainable peaceful dream.

"I looked at that and the fact that they classify warring factions during civil war anarchy shows that what I classify as anarchy has never been tried"
I wonder why... The fact is any form of anarchy would fall apart in 2 years and small tribes would spring up when people come together to unit under similar ideals including the interest of protection and future well being.

The leaders of these tribes would then go on to attack nearby tribes with the intention of assimilating them. Eventually one of these tribes would rule the entire country, the laws adopted by that tribe would be enforced throughout and you would find a country thats governments aren't that much different from the ones today.
